USCIS guidelines regarding priority dates and cross-chargeability can significantly impact the Green Card application timeline for many immigrants. Understanding these factors is crucial for applicants navigating the immigration process.
Key Details:
- Priority dates determine the eligibility for Green Card applications based on visa availability.
- Cross-chargeability allows applicants to use the country of their spouse or parent to potentially expedite their application.
- The current visa bulletin provides specific dates for various categories and countries, influencing processing times.
- Applicants should regularly check updates to the visa bulletin to stay informed about changes that may affect their case.
